FedRAMP Moderate spans the CMMC Level 2 baseline
CMMC Level 2 is built on the 110 requirements in NIST SP 800-171, a subset of the NIST SP 800-53 controls behind FedRAMP Moderate. Because GovDash holds FedRAMP Moderate Equivalency, that baseline already encompasses the CMMC Level 2 control set.
GovDash supports CMMC requirements for processing, storing, and transmitting CUI
GovDash has achieved FedRAMP Moderate Equivalency as defined by the Department of Defense's December 2023 memorandum from the DoD CIO. Our cloud service offering was independently assessed by a FedRAMP-recognized Third Party Assessment Organization (3PAO) against all 323 controls in the FedRAMP Moderate security baseline, with zero findings. The environment is validated to store, process, and transmit eligible CUI and CDI in support of contracts subject to DFARS 252.204-7012 and CMMC Level 2 requirements.

No single product makes an organization CMMC certified. Certification is issued to your organization based on an assessment of your environment, people, and processes. GovDash provides AI infrastructure with controls aligned to NIST SP 800-171 and FedRAMP Moderate that support your Level 2 requirements when handling eligible CUI, reducing the compliance burden your team carries into an assessment.

GovDash provides and enforces the technical controls. Your organization determines which users are authorized to access CUI based on your own vetting, access policies, and CMMC authorization boundary. Customers are also responsible for properly classifying uploaded documents and artifacts. These responsibilities are documented in our Customer Responsibility Matrix.
